Chapter Six: Out of the Widerness and Headed Southwest!


Well, I finally got my butt moving and decided to change my birthday weekend ressie from DVC to a regular resort reservation, using the latest discount code. (I called because I wasn't sure how to use the code when I accessed the on-line system.) Guess I waited a bit too long because there were no rooms left at Wilderness Lodge... that is, unless I wanted to book Club Level! :snooty:

Yikes! Even with the discount that would be about $350 more than a Woods-View room for the three nights. Sorry, too rich for my blood!

Tried the Poly and discovered the same thing... no rooms left on the discount except Theme Park View, Concierge... for a cool $1400, with the code! :faint: Same for the Contemporary! Time to look beyond the Magic Kingdom Area....

I was somewhat tempted by a pretty good rate for a standard room at Animal Kingdom Lodge, but, we just stayed at Kidani Village last Fall and my heart yearned for something a little different.

Keeping in mind that I still have to save for our Family Vacation next June, I decided to look at the Moderates and try for our old romantic favorite, Port Orleans French Quarter. (Romantic for us because we honeymooned in N'awlins.) No King Beds there, or at Riverside for that matter.

Hey now, what's the point of getting two double beds if this is supposed to be a romantic getaway?!

The reservationist did find a King-bed room available at Coronado Springs... and the price was definitely right. I decided to book it! :woohoo:


Coronado_Springs_Resort_Exterior_25.jpg



At first I was a little disappointed about not being close to the MK, but on the other hand, we've never stayed at CSR before and I love trying new resorts at Disney! It's always an adventure exploring a new place.

I know that the rooms there have been renovated recently and I'm really happy to get a King room. It also makes me feel better to know that I'm saving money by switching from a Deluxe to a Mod and that I'm making good use of the discount code. Less guilt = More fun!

Since I just got back from a stay there, I'll throw in my two cents. :rolleyes: I know you said you requested Cabanas, but just in case you didn't know - Casitas 4 and 5 are closest to the first bus stop, to be picked up and to be let off, if that is of any importance to you. It's also the prettiest part of the resort imo. Longest bus ride was to DTD, furthest park is MK, and really that seemed pretty short as well (unless it was the end of the day, and you were standing......). We didn't eat at PepperMarket, but just a little tip if you do, get it to go and eat at the tables outside by the lake - its a nice view, plus it saves you that 10% mandatory tip :thumbsup2
